Key Responsibilities
Support the implementation and ongoing maintenance of BMS's AI governance framework, including archetype-based control models covering risk classification, control objectives, implementation patterns, and acceptable evidence standards.
Conduct structured risk assessments of AI and GenAI tools being considered for enterprise adoption, evaluating each against BMS's risk appetite, security standards, and regulatory obligations prior to deployment approval.
Execute AI risk and conformity assessments aligned to EU AI Act, NIST AI RMF, ISO/IEC 42001, and applicable global privacy regulations (GDPR, EDPB, state-level AI laws), including risk classification for use cases across Clinical, Commercial, and R&D domains.
Assess GenAI tools and LLM deployments — including Claude (via AWS Bedrock), ChatGPT, and other third-party services — for data privacy, contractual, and data residency implications; document findings and escalate issues as appropriate.
Partner with business and technology stakeholders to document and track controls for approved AI technologies, ensuring controls are practical, embedded in workflows, and aligned to identified risks.
Execute control testing activities for AI-specific controls, including pre-deployment validation, post-deployment effectiveness testing, and periodic re-assessments; document results, gaps, and remediation plans and track findings through to closure.
Maintain GRC platform records (ServiceNow, OneTrust) for AI risk assessments, control testing results, and issue tracking, ensuring data quality and audit readiness at all times.
Prepare risk assessment summaries, control testing reports, and governance dashboards to support leadership reporting and stakeholder communications.
Monitor the evolving AI regulatory landscape — including EU AI Act developments, NIST updates, and emerging state-level AI laws — and summarize implications for BMS programs.
Support the tracking and assessment of risks from next-generation AI capabilities including agentic AI, multi-modal GenAI, synthetic data pipelines, and quantum-accelerated inference.
Qualifications & Requirements
Education
- Bachelor's degree required in Information Security, Computer Science, Risk Management, Data Science, or a related field.
Experience — Required
8–10 years of progressive experience in GRC, information security, or technology risk, with at least 1–2 years directly focused on AI, emerging technology, or data governance.
Hands-on experience executing GRC control assessments or technology risk reviews in a large, complex enterprise environment.
Working knowledge of AI governance frameworks: NIST AI RMF, EU AI Act, and/or ISO/IEC 42001 or 23894.
Familiarity with LLM/GenAI risk concepts including prompt injection, hallucination risk, IP leakage, and training data privacy.
Understanding of cloud-based AI deployment architectures and data residency/privacy implications of BMS-controlled vs. third-party SaaS environments.
Strong analytical, documentation, and communication skills with the ability to translate technical risk findings into clear, actionable outputs.
Ability to work effectively in a global, cross-timezone environment with onshore and offshore teams.
Experience — Preferred
Experience in Life Sciences, Pharma, or a highly regulated industry (FDA oversight, GxP, clinical data governance).
Exposure to AI gateway architecture, API security controls, and control plane governance.
Familiarity with agentic AI systems, model cards, data lineage frameworks, and model lifecycle governance.
Experience with GRC platform tooling (ServiceNow, OneTrust).
